Details of the monthly rent price:
Net rent CHF 1'940.-
Flat-rate charges CHF 210.-
Furniture (indicative) CHF 1'160.-
Not included in the rent are the costs for electricity, Wifi, parking, etc.
In the volume of a completely renovated old barn, in the heart of Courfaivre, this duplex of approx. 128 m² living space with careful finishes, where the old beam structure and an old staircase dialogue with a contemporary layout.
Entrance level - spacious open living area with fully equipped kitchen: central island with granite countertop, bar, oven, stove, dishwasher and refrigerator. Many windows provide good lighting and a view of the village, the church tower and the hills. This level also accommodates 2 bedrooms and a parental suite with contemporary bathroom, double sink, Italian shower and WC, as well as a bathroom with bathtub, WC and private washing machine (washing machine + dryer).
Upper floor - an open, heated mezzanine (office, reading corner or guest room), extended by a loggia of approx. 20 m²: a covered outdoor space with a view of the village.

About the surfaces
The announced 128 m² correspond to the living area (areas with a minimum height of 1.50 m under the ceiling). The floor area of the apartment is approx. 160 m²: under an old beam structure, the perceived volume is therefore much more generous than the living area. The detailed plan, attached to this announcement, specifies the calculation room by room.
Situation - a village that lives
In the heart of Courfaivre (municipality of Haute-Sorne), a stone's throw from the church and the cantonal road that crosses the village - a central and lively location, with everything you need for daily life:
Shops, bakery, tea room, post office and restaurant in the immediate vicinity
A real village life: cultural and sports center, gym, football, local associations, concerts, markets and festivals - ideal for those who love social life
For families: primary school in the village (Haute-Sorne school district) a few minutes' walk away, and kindergarten/care facility "les Pachats" on site, from birth to the end of primary school, open from 6:30 am to 6:30 pm
Nature at the gates of the village: the Sorne, the hills and the Jura trails
A lively village center, with traffic on the cantonal road and the church bells that rhythmically accompany the life of the villagers.
Mobility
Bus stop in less than a minute and Courfaivre train station in about 10 minutes on foot, with Delémont in 8 minutes by train (half-hourly frequency, 7 days a week) and connections to Basel, Biel and Porrentruy. Ideal for those who do not depend on a private vehicle.
